2009并行计算与多核程序设计11-12Linux多线程编程.ppt
qw****27
亲,该文档总共44页,到这已经超出免费预览范围,如果喜欢就直接下载吧~
相关资料
2009并行计算与多核程序设计11-12Linux多线程编程.ppt
并行计算与多核程序设计理论课11-12Linux多线程AgendaPOSIX线程库Pthreads介绍使用fork创建进程和使用POSIX线程库差别POSIXpthreads库POSIXpthreads库(续)使用Pthreads编写的程序例子使用Pthreads编写的程序例子(续)使用Pthreads编写的程序例子(续2)线程可通过三种方法来终止执行线程的撤销Agenda线程的属性CPU亲和力栈溢出保护区线程并行级别栈大小线程数据类型AgendaAgendaMutex条件变量信号量读写锁线程和信号处理A
多核程序设计Linux多线程编程.ppt
Linux多线程编程Linux多线程编程线程互斥和同步——Mutex条件变量线程的撤销清理实例程序
理学多核程序设计Windows多线程编程及调试.pptx
1使用Win32线程API线程同步的实现事件(Event)事件(Event)临界区临界区互斥量信号量信号量MFC线程同步实现MFC线程同步实现.NETFramework多线程的实现.NET框架下同步机制实现
多线程与多核编程.doc
第13章多线程与多核编程多任务的并发执行会用到多线程(multithreading),而CPU的多核(mult-core)化又将原来只在巨型机中才使用的并行计算(parallelcomputing)带入普通PC应用的多核程序设计(multi-coreprogramming)中。13.1进程与线程进程(process)是执行中的程序,线程(thread)是一种轻量级的进程。13.1.1进程与多任务现代的操作系统都是多任务(multitask)的,即可同时运行多个程序。进程(process)是位于内存中正被C
多核程序设计课件5-windows多线程编程.ppt
第四章Windows多线程编程及调优Windows多线程APIWindows线程库使用win32线程API_beginthread使用_beginthread创建线程的例子线程管理设置线程的优先级线程的挂起与恢复线程等待线程终结Win32多线程的实现Win32多线程的实现(续)线程执行和资源存取Win32线程同步的实现-全局变量用全局变量同步线程的例子事件使用“事件”机制注意事项事件机制例子临界区CS相关API互斥量例子续1续2信号量使用信号量机制同步线程例子例子续续2原子操作原子操作(续)线程池线程池(